A. T. Olmstead
Albert Ten Eyck Olmstead (1880-1945) was an American archaeologist and historian specializing in ancient Near Eastern studies. His research focused on the history and culture of ancient Mesopotamia, particularly Assyria. Olmstead's work in decipheing and analyzing Assyrian historical inscriptions has been instrumental in shaping our understanding of ancient Near Eastern civilizations. His contributions to the field of Assyriology have been widely recognized for their depth and scholarly rigor.
